Housing in Grand Forks costs 3.4ร the median income, below the national average of 4.5ร. The median home price is $243K and median rent is $908/month. Grand Forks ranks #97 of 373 metros for affordability.

Rent (ZORI)
$1,173/mo
1yr: +7.8%5yr: +32.8%
Note: ZORI reflects current listing prices and may differ from the Census ACS median rent shown above, which captures what renters actually pay including below-market and subsidized units.
